A curious comment from the DOU feed:
November 4. /Dow Jones/. The British pound/U.S. dollar pair is up 3 cents from Tuesday's low of 1.6260, and the rise provides another opportunity for selling. The pair's recent rise above 1.66 has been hampered. That said, ahead of Thursday's Bank of England meeting, market participants are unlikely to build up long positions in the pair at current high levels. At the time of writing, the pair Pound/Dollar was trading at 1.6540, with short-term resistance located at 1.6605. Probably, you should open short positions on pair between the current level and resistance, place stop orders above recently reached high 1.6690 and fix profit at approach of Tuesday's low 1.6260.
